Nutriband Inc. (NASDAQ: NTRB, NTRBW) is a developer of prescription transdermal pharmaceutical products, with a primary focus on its AVERSA abuse-deterrent transdermal technology and its lead product candidate, an abuse-deterrent fentanyl patch. The Nutriband news stream highlights how the company is advancing this technology platform, interacting with regulators, and managing its corporate structure to support product development.
Readers of the Nutriband news page can follow regulatory and clinical development updates, including the company’s reported meetings with the U.S. Food and Drug Administration on the Chemistry, Manufacturing, and Controls plans and the 505(b)(2) NDA pathway for AVERSA Fentanyl. News items also cover Nutriband’s summaries of FDA feedback on in vitro studies to characterize abuse-deterrent properties and its intention to move toward an IND filing in support of a Human Abuse Potential clinical study.
The company’s releases also describe intellectual property developments, such as a provisional patent application to enhance AVERSA technology and U.S. patent actions related to abuse and misuse deterrent transdermal systems, alongside references to a broad patent portfolio covering AVERSA in multiple countries. Corporate and capital markets news includes announcements of a preferred stock dividend tied to future FDA approval of AVERSA Fentanyl, the sale of a majority stake in subsidiary Pocono Pharmaceutical to EarthVision Bio, and Nutriband’s inclusion in Russell indexes.
Additional coverage includes partnership and collaboration news, such as agreements with Kindeva Drug Delivery for product development, Brand Institute for commercial brand name creation, and a non-binding Letter of Intent with the Qvanta Group to explore advanced technology support for abuse-deterrent pharmaceutical innovation. Nutriband Inc. (NASDAQ:NTRB, NTRBW) announced progress in collaboration with Kindeva Drug Delivery for their AVERSA™ Fentanyl patch, an abuse-deterrent transdermal system. Recent studies confirm that Nutriband's aversive coating can be produced with standard manufacturing processes, crucial for product development. The product has a projected peak annual sales potential of $80M - $200M within five years post-launch. Nutriband aims to finalize product configuration and transfer technology to Kindeva's commercial facility in California.

Nutriband Inc. (NASDAQ:NTRB) reported significant growth in its Q2 2022 financial results, achieving record quarterly revenue of $0.5 million, a 113% increase year-over-year. Over six months, revenue rose 44%. The company received a favorable court ruling enabling the cancellation of 1.2 million shares, representing 15% of outstanding shares at the time. Nutriband continues to expand its AVERSA™ intellectual property, now protected in 45 countries. However, net loss increased to $1.0 million from $0.5 million year-over-year.
Nutriband Inc. (NASDAQ:NTRB, NTRBW) announced the effective date of a 7:6 forward stock split that took place on August 12, 2022, with a record date of August 15, 2022. Each holder of 6 shares of common stock received 7 shares, with no change to the per-share par value. The stock split will not affect stockholders' equity percentages. Additionally, the exercise price of outstanding warrants will be adjusted to $6.43 per share, corresponding to the stock split ratio. Book-entry holders do not need to take action, while those seeking stock certificates will receive further instructions.

Nutriband Inc. (NASDAQ:NTRB)(NASDAQ:NTRBW) announced a favorable Final Judgment allowing the cancellation of 1.2 million shares, approximately 15% of its outstanding shares, previously issued for an acquisition now rescinded. This cancellation, expected to be processed within one business day, will reduce Nutriband's total outstanding shares to 6.6 million. The company is focused on developing transdermal pharmaceutical products, including its lead product, an abuse deterrent fentanyl patch utilizing the AVERSA technology.
